Listmates, we have a client with a large parcel that wishes to do a testamentary division into several parcels for his heirs. Any words of wisdom, warnings, advice etc? I have looked at the statute and it appears that there is nothing overly complex about the process which is what concerns me. We have legal descriptions that meet zoning requirements and a survey. We bequest Lot one to Larry, 2 to Curley and 3 to Moe and so on. As long as no heir gets adjoining lots we should not have an issue correct? Let me know what I am missing! Thanks, Craig
